It will ultimately be the job of jury president Pedro Almodovar, reputed to be a fun- loving guy, to decide what the awards legacy of this milestone festival will be—celebratory or sobering. As the world at large screeches into a sharp right turn politically, indications are that the world’s most glamorous film festival has invited films that address a broad menu of global issues. Meanwhile, in the competition selection, both Kornel Mundruczo’s “Jupiter’s Moon,” and Michael Haneke’s “Happy End,” fictionally deal with refugees. Fatih Akin’s “In the Fade” stars Dianne Kruger in a tale of racism and neo- Nazis.

Sure to be hotly anticipated, both for the director’s awards history and for the project’s film- world subject matter, is “Redoubtable” by Michel Hazanavicius, a comedy/drama biopic of Jean- Luc Godard, with Louis Garrel in the lead.

Hazanavicius was a popular favorite with “The Artist” in 2. Palme. His vindication came in the form of five Oscars, an additional five nominations, and three Golden Globes.

This is his first time back at Cannes since 2. The Search,” a true dud set during the conflict in Chechnya. Todd Haynes was a popular favorite to win the Palme in 2. Carol,” but the jury had other ideas, awarding only Best Actress to Rooney Mara. He comes to Cannes with “Wonderstruck,” involving two stories linked across fifty years, and starring Michelle Williams, Julianne Moore, and Amy Hargreaves. A dysfunctional family is at the center of Yorgos Lanthimos’ “The Killing of a Sacred Deer,” starring Nicole Kidman, Alicia Silverstone and Colin Farrell. Nobody does dysfunction and a thrillingly perverse, twisted world view like this Greek director, who first came to attention with his Oscar- nominated bizarre family drama “Dogtooth,” winner of the 2.

S. It’s hinted to be loaded with sex and nudity. One tradition Cannes stubbornly adheres to in this anniversary year is maintaining the predominant maleness and ethnic whiteness of the competition. Asia is represented with three films, two Korean and one Japanese, and Africa is nowhere to be seen. Hong Sangsoo (the prolific School of the Art Institute of Chicago alum) competes with “The Day After,” and Bong Joon- ho (known for “Snowpiercer” and “The Host”) competes with “Okja,” a sci- fi drama that features a gentle monster.

This year she’s in competition with “The Beguiled,” a Civil War story that may sound familiar because, like the Clint Eastwood film of the same title, it’s based on Thomas Cullinan’s novel.

Advertisement. A Cannes track record is no guarantee of success at the festival. Some relative newcomers get the chance at a career in this 7. Press opinion can predict a new winner daily, but only the jury decides. American indie sibling co- directors Benny Safdie and Josh Safdie, are this year’s newest newbies in competition with crime drama “Good Time.” Noah Baumbach is in the Cannes competition for the first time with “The Meyerowitz Stories,” a contentious family drama featuring an intriguing lineup of stars including Adam Sandler, Emma Thompson, Ben Stiller, Dustin Hoffman and Candice Bergen.
